‘Some tactical problems in digital simulation’ for the next 10 years

B L Nelson

Journal of Simulation, 2016, vol. 10, issue 1, 2-11

Abstract: In his influential 1963 paper ‘Some Tactical Problems in Digital Simulation’, Conway identified important issues that became the pillars of research in simulation analysis methodology. Naturally these ‘problems’ were a product of the applications of interest at the time, as well as the state of simulation and computing, much of which has changed dramatically. In light of those changes, we attempt to identify the tactical problems that might occupy simulation researchers for the next 10 years.
